Want to experience downtown Olympia with streets made up of over 100 art galleries, performances, and creative happenings? That’s exactly what you’ll find at Olympia Arts Walk Friday, April 26 and Saturday, April 27, 2024, featuring:

  • 100 Olympia businesses and organizations hosting local artists and art events
  • A street closure transforming seven blocks of Downtown Olympia into a free activity area, Arts Market, busking zone, and place to gather and celebrate art and community
  • The Procession of the Species Saturday 4:30pm and Luminary Procession Friday 8:30pm – celebrating nature in community presented by Earthbound Productions (https://oly-wa.us/procession/)

SPSCC faculty members Liza Brenner and Olympia Poet Laureate Kathleen Byrd will be showing paintings and poems and broadsides respectively at KXXO Mixx 96.1 at 119 Washington St. NE, with work by their students as well. Byrd will host a poetry reading Friday evening also featuring SPSCC students.
